How does the word tajdid (renewal) fit the Arabic 'ta-f'il' pattern?
tajdid follows the exact ta-C1-C2-i-C3 pattern taught in this lesson. Its three-letter root is j-d-d, which is the same root found in jadid (new). By putting these root letters into the ta-f'il pattern, we get tajdid, which literally means 'making something new' or 'renewal'.
Is takhsis (allocation) another example of the 'ta-f'il' pattern?
Yes, it perfectly matches the pattern. The root here is kh-s-s, which you might recognize from related words like khass (special) and makhsus (specific). Applying the ta-f'il pattern to this root creates takhsis, which means assigning or allocating something for a specific purpose.
I see jadid (new) at the end of the noun phrase, but how does the plural noun manābe' (resources) work here?
manābe' is an Arabic broken plural. Its singular form is manba', meaning 'source' or 'resource'. B2 learners should note that it follows the mafā'il broken plural pattern, which is very common for nouns starting with an 'm' prefix.
Why do we use the preposition be right before takhsis instead of closer to vābasteh?
In Farsi, the adjective vābasteh (dependent) requires the preposition be (to/on) to introduce the thing being depended upon. The structure is vābasteh be [noun phrase] ast. The preposition be must go at the very beginning of the noun phrase it modifies, which is why it sits before takhsis-e manābe'-e jadid rather than next to vābasteh.
